Microsoft 365 Administrator (MS-102) Practice Exam
The Microsoft 365 Administrator (MS-102) exam is designed for professionals who are responsible for deploying and managing Microsoft 365 services and have a comprehensive understanding of the various workloads within the Microsoft 365 ecosystem. These administrators play a crucial role in integrating and coordinating different workloads, ensuring smooth operation across the entire Microsoft 365 environment. They collaborate with architects and other administrators to manage various aspects such as infrastructure, identity, security, compliance, endpoints, and applications to ensure efficient and effective implementation and administration of Microsoft 365 services.
Who should take the exam?
As an exam candidate, you must have practical expertise across all Microsoft 365 workloads and Microsoft Enterprise ID, having administered at least one of these components. Additionally, you should demonstrate proficiency in the following areas:
- Networking
- Server administration
- Domain Name System (DNS)
- PowerShell usage
Exam Details
- Exam Code: MS-102
- Exam Name: Microsoft 365 Administrator
- Exam Languages: English, Chinese (Simplified), German, Spanish, French, Japanese, Portuguese (Brazil)
- Exam Questions: 40-60 Questions
- Passing Score: 700 or greater (On a scale 1 - 1000)
MS-102 Exam Course Outline
The Exam covers the given topics -
Topic 1: Understand deploying and managing a Microsoft 365 tenant (25–30%)
Implementing and managing a Microsoft 365 tenant
- Create a tenant
- Implement and manage domains
- Configure organizational settings, including security, privacy, and profile
- Identify and respond to service health issues
- Configure notifications in service health
- Monitor adoption and usage
Managing users and groups
- Create and manage users
- Create and manage guest users
- Create and manage contacts
- Create and manage groups, including Microsoft 365 groups
- Manage and monitor Microsoft 365 license allocations
- Perform bulk user management, including PowerShell
Managing roles in Microsoft 365
- Manage roles in Microsoft 365 and Microsoft Entra
- Manage role groups for Microsoft Defender, Microsoft Purview, and Microsoft 365 workloads
- Manage delegation by using administrative units
- Implement privileged identity management for Microsoft Entra roles
Topic 2: Implementing and managing Microsoft Entra identity and access (25–30%)
Managing identity synchronization with Microsoft Entra tenant
- Prepare for identity synchronization by using IdFix
- Implement and manage directory synchronization by using Microsoft Entra Connect cloud sync
- Implement and manage directory synchronization by using Microsoft Entra Connect
- Monitor synchronization by using Microsoft Entra Connect Health
- Troubleshoot synchronization, including Microsoft Entra Connect and Microsoft Entra Connect cloud sync
Implementing and managing authentication
- Implement and manage authentication methods, including Windows Hello for Business, passwordless, tokens, and the Microsoft Authenticator app
- Implement and manage self-service password reset (SSPR)
- Implement and manage Microsoft Entra Password Protection
- Implement and manage multi-factor authentication (MFA)
- Investigate and resolve authentication issues
Implementing and managing secure access
- Plan for identity protection
- Implement and manage Microsoft Entra ID Protection
- Plan Conditional Access policies
- Implement and manage Conditional Access policies
Topic 3: Managing security and threats by using Microsoft 365 Defender (25–30%)
Managing security reports and alerts by using the Microsoft 365 Defender portal
- Review and take actions to improve the Microsoft Secure Score in the Microsoft 365 Defender portal
- Review and respond to security incidents and alerts in Microsoft 365 Defender
- Review and respond to issues identified in security and compliance reports in Microsoft 365 Defender
- Review and respond to threats identified in threat analytics
Implementing email and collaboration protection by using Microsoft Defender for Office 365
- Implement policies and rules in Defender for Office 365
- Review and respond to threats identified in Defender for Office 365, including threats and investigations
- Create and run campaigns, such as attack simulation
- Unblock users
Managing endpoint protection by using Microsoft Defender for Endpoint
- Onboard devices to Defender for Endpoint
- Configure Defender for Endpoint settings
- Review and respond to endpoint vulnerabilities
- Review and respond to risks identified in the Microsoft Defender Vulnerability Management dashboard
Topic 4: Managing compliance by using Microsoft Purview (15–20%)
Implementing Microsoft Purview information protection and data lifecycle management
- Implement and manage sensitive info types by using keywords, keyword lists, or regular expressions
- Implementing retention labels, retention label policies, and retention policies
- Implement sensitivity labels and sensitivity label policies
Implementing Microsoft Purview data loss prevention (DLP)
- Implement DLP for workloads
- Implement Endpoint DLP
- Review and respond to DLP alerts, events, and reports
